Project Engineer - Structural
About the role
A Project Substation Structural Engineer within QISG is involved in a variety of engineering projects with a focus on structural aspects of energy related infrastructure and design-build delivery methods for large-scale energy and substation-related projects. Collaborating with an in-house, multi-disciplinary engineering and construction team — including civil, structural, geotechnical, construction management, and construction experts — the Project Substation Structural Engineer plays a crucial role in providing structural design solutions; responsibilities include overseeing and supporting design production, contributing to the development of construction drawings and specifications, and engineering support during construction and erection.
Responsibilities
- Execute assignments requiring application of standard and advanced engineering techniques, procedures, and criteria to carry out structural related engineering tasks to support substation design.
- Perform structural engineering analyses for design of energy infrastructure buildings & building components, substation auxiliary support structures, deep foundations, retaining structures, protective blast walls, and other heavy civil and energy related structural systems.
- Perform finite element modeling for various concrete or steel structures and develop associated reports for client and permit review.
- Interface closely with other project-level and senior leadership personnel within the company, including geotechnical, geological, structural, transmission line, and civil engineering, GIS, and construction management team members.
- Develop written reports and/or provide verbal communication of information in a professional and appropriate manner.
- Participation in sector focused professional organizations, and attendance and presentations at industry events.
- Work under supervision of Engineering Director, Engineering Manager, and/or a Senior Engineer in a professional office setting.
Requirements
- Bachelor’s degree in Civil Engineering from an ABET accredited university
- Professional Engineer (P.E.) licensure
- Minimum 5 years design experience in the structural engineering field working with concrete and steel materials to support substation design
- Familiarity with the use of the following computer software: RISA, SPColumn, and AutoDesk INVENTOR
- Excellent written and verbal communication skills. Proficient with Microsoft Word, Excel, PowerPoint, Outlook, and Teams
- Ability to work with moderate supervision and maximum efficiency in a small or medium size office setting
- Substation structure design experience
- Experience in structural design of various foundation types include mat foundations, pile foundations (helical, driven, bored), and drilled shaft foundations
- Familiarity with the use of the following computer software: AutoCAD (with or without the Advanced Steel Extension), Revit, LPILE, GROUP, FAD, SHAFT, APILE
